Táin Bó Cúailgne Cattle Raid
One of the major Celtic legends is the Cattle Raid of Cooley, also known as Táin Bó Cúailgne in which Queen Medb of Connacht takes a war band to Ulster to capture the brown bull of Cuailgne.

Vercingetorix
Vercingetorix was a king of the temporarily united Gallic tribes fighting to keep Gaul free of Caesar and Roman domination.
